Understanding Gamification in the Digital Age
Gamification refers to the application of game mechanics—such as points, challenges, leaderboards, and rewards—in non-gaming contexts, including e-commerce, app engagement, and customer loyalty programs. The Power of Interactive Promotions: A New Paradigm
Among the most effective implementations of gamification are interactive promotions—campaigns that invite consumers to participate actively in a game, often with the chance of winning prizes or discounts. These initiatives serve proprietary brand goals, enabling firms to gather valuable data while incentivising repeat engagement.
Interactive promotions capitalize on consumers’ need for instant gratification and social validation. They create a sense of community and excitement, which are essential for building loyalty in saturated markets. Retail, gaming, and entertainment sectors have all embraced these tactics, often integrating them into loyalty apps or digital campaigns.

Differentiating Premium Campaigns in a Crowded Market
While many brands adopt simple discounting, premium brands opt for complex gamified experiences that deepen emotional connections. These can include personalized avatars, exclusive rewards, or tiered challenges—elements that enhance perceived value and turn casual participants into loyal advocates.
